    I'm soon to be 31 years old, and I decided to want a change in my life. I'm at 254 today, and I'm hoping to lose 70lbs. Sigh... Seems like such a feat.

    You probably won't believe this, but it isn't such a feat to lose 70 pounds when we have a lot to lose. All it takes is to start, and to keep on going. You, yes YOU, can do it.

    You are never too old or too out of shape to start. I was 255 when I started, 105 pounds over goal weight. I was 53 (my birthday) when I started. I'm still 53. I'm down 75 pounds and counting.

    Not only have I lost the weight but I've been very fit and healthy... you get to that point long before you get to goal weight and it feels........... GREAT.

    All you need to do is ... start. The first pounds come off fairly easily and help motivate you to keep going. Just start. Now. The future you will thank current you for taking that step.

    Yes, I know it feels daunting. I felt that too, for several months, mostly because I was soldiering on all by myself, for most of it. YOU folks have an advantage - you have the support of people here, and all the inspirational stories that can prove to you that it can be done.
